One of the purest GAA fingerprints on the site. The Camogie, Hurler and Gaelic Football counts run at roughly three hundred, two hundred and one hundred and fifty times the global baseline respectively — the county's century-long rivalries with Kilkenny and Tipperary rendered as statistics. Off the pitch, a thick Author bench carries Frank O'Connor and the Munster short-story tradition.
